app开发心得经验
添加项目经理微信 获取更多优惠
复制微信号
APP开发心得经验
在现代社会,APP已经成为人们生活中不可或缺的一部分。随着移动互联网的快速发展,APP开发也逐渐成为一个热门的技术领域。以下是一些关于APP开发的心得经验,旨在帮助新手开发者更好地理解和掌握这一领域。
明确项目目标
在开始APP开发之前,首先要明确项目的具体目标。这些目标需要详细到可以被量化和跟踪。目标设置应遵循SMART原则,即具体、可衡量、可达成、相关、时限。明确项目目标有助于团队在开发过程中保持一致,确保最终产品能够满足用户需求。
进行市场调研
市场调研是APP开发的重要环节。通过深入的调研,开发者可以了解目标用户的需求、竞争对手的现状以及市场趋势。这一过程可以通过问卷调查、用户访谈等方式进行,帮助开发者更精准地制定产品特性和设计理念。
选择合适的开发平台
选择合适的开发平台是成功开发APP的关键。常见的平台包括iOS和Android,开发者需要根据目标市场和用户群体的特性选择最合适的开发平台。此外,跨平台解决方案如React Native和Flutter也越来越受到欢迎,它们可以让开发者在多个平台上创建单个代码库,从而节省开发时间和成本。
注重用户体验设计
用户体验(UX)是APP成功的关键因素之一。设计要以用户为中心,确保界面简洁、美观,操作流畅。开发者应考虑到用户的视觉体验和交互流程,减少用户的学习成本。良好的用户体验不仅能提高用户满意度,还能直接促进应用的下载量和用户留存率。
实施敏捷开发策略
敏捷开发方法论强调迭代、灵活和协作,能够适应项目需求的变化。通过短周期的迭代开发,团队能够持续评估项目进度和产品质量。每个开发周期结束后,团队应评估进度,并根据反馈进行调整,以确保项目能够顺利进行。
进行全面的测试
测试是保障APP质量的重要环节。全面的测试应该包括功能测试、性能测试、安全性测试和用户接受测试(UAT)。通过测试,开发者可以发现和修复应用程序的问题,确保其运行稳定、安全和符合预期功能。此外,Beta测试可以向限定用户群开放,收集用户反馈进行改进。
持续更新和迭代
APP的开发不是一蹴而就的,需要持续的更新和迭代,以满足市场和用户不断变化的需求。定期发布应用的新版本,增加新功能、修复已知问题,并通过数据分析了解用户的使用习惯和需求,为后续的开发提供参考。
总结
APP开发是一个复杂而富有挑战性的过程,涉及多个技术方向和团队协作。通过明确项目目标、进行市场调研、选择合适的开发平台、注重用户体验设计、实施敏捷开发策略、进行全面的测试以及持续更新和迭代,开发者可以有效提升APP的质量和用户满意度。随着技术的不断进步,开发者需要保持学习的态度,及时更新自己的知识和技能,以适应快速变化的市场需求。
在这个过程中,开发者不仅要关注技术的实现,还要关注用户的反馈和体验。通过不断的优化和改进,才能在竞争激烈的市场中脱颖而出,创造出真正满足用户需求的优秀应用。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!